ホームページ  >  記事  >  ウェブフロントエンド  >  uniapp はどのように動作環境を決定しますか?

uniapp はどのように動作環境を決定しますか?

coldplay.xixi
coldplay.xixiオリジナル
2020-12-08 15:04:368899ブラウズ

Uniapp の実行環境を決定する方法: [process.env.NODE_ENV] を使用して、現在の環境が開発環境であるか本番環境であるかを決定できます。コードは [if(process.env.NODE_ENV] です。 === '開発'){ console.log]。

uniapp はどのように動作環境を決定しますか?

#このチュートリアルの動作環境: Windows7 システム、uni-app2.5.1 バージョン、thinkpad t480 コンピューター。

推奨事項 (無料): uni-app 開発チュートリアル

uniapp が実行環境を決定する方法:

uni-app process.env.NODE_ENV を使用して、現在の環境が開発環境であるか運用環境であるかを判断できます。通常は、テスト サーバーと運用サーバーの間の動的な切り替えに使用されます。

  • HBuilderX では、[実行] をクリックしてコンパイルされたコードが開発環境、[リリース] をクリックしてコンパイルされたコードが本番環境です。

  • cli モードは一般的なコンパイル環境の処理方法です。

  • if(process.env.NODE_ENV === 'development'){
        console.log('开发环境')
    }else{
        console.log('生产环境')
    }
テスト環境など、さらに多くの環境をカスタマイズする必要がある場合:

  • 構成する必要があるのは 1 つのプラットフォームのみであると仮定すると、 can package.json 構成では、HBuilderX の実行およびリリース メニューにもう 1 つあります。

  • すべてのプラットフォームに設定されている場合は、vue-config.js で設定できます。

クイック コード ブロック

# コード ブロック uEnvDev と uEnvProd を HBuilderX に入力すると、開発および運用に対応する実行環境決定コードが迅速に生成されます。

// uEnvDev
if (process.env.NODE_ENV === 'development') {
    // TODO
}
// uEnvProd
if (process.env.NODE_ENV === 'production') {
    // TODO
}

関連する無料学習の推奨事項:

プログラミング ビデオ

以上がuniapp はどのように動作環境を決定しますか?の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

声明:
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。